## Authentication

The Quillbay SDKs (Kotlin and Swift) share identical auth flows as of v3.1: both exchange a plugin key for a scoped bearer token with matching refresh semantics and error codes. Plugin authors should test against the sandbox tenant. For sandbox requests, include the credential shown below.

portal login ticket: eyJhbGciOiJIUzI1NiIsInR5cCI6IkpXVCJ9.eyJzdWIiOiI0Z4ywpUMsBIn0.ca5FVhkdBXa3

Escalation path, Quillbus broker upgrade: reviewer signs off only after the staging soak (24h, no consumer lag alerts). If the upgrade stalls mid-migration, do NOT roll back partitions manually — trigger the revert playbook and freeze producer deploys. Page the messaging on-call first; if unacked in 15 minutes, page the platform lead. Data-loss suspicion escalates immediately to incident commander, severity 1. Document every manual step in the upgrade log. Unresolved questions during review go to the broker team inbox.

alerts address for yajof-kahog: eliax@qirvanlabs.corp

Plugin authors extending Crumbhaven's order flow should know the cutoff check now runs server-side only; client-side estimates are advisory. If your plugin adjusts lead times, return minutes, not hours, and never negative values, or the validator rejects the order silently. The cutoff constants your overrides are measured against appear below.

tuning table, kajog-bawip:
TIERS = {
    "kelius": 256,
    "lammir": 543,
}